Trek 2000 Corporation is a holding company that was formed in 1986 when Gord and Maureen Haddock brought The Body Shop franchise to Saskatchewan. Prior to this, Gord and Maureen had owned several businesses, both franchise and independent.
They gained experience with music supply stores, entertainment booking agencies, drug stores, stereo shops, land development, and food services.

Serial Entrepreneurs
Over the years, Trek 2000 Corporation and its founders, Gord and Maureen Haddock, have built and managed a wide range of businesses, spanning retail, entertainment, publishing, and land development.
Today, Trek 2000 Corporation continues to grow with a 47th Street Warehouse and development partnerships like 3twenty Rentals and Future 500.
